The Substack App

The first and most straightforward option for writing on Substack using your mobile device is the Substack app. The app is available for both iOS and Android devices and provides a simple and user-friendly interface for writing and publishing your content. The app allows you to access all of your subscriptions, read articles, and manage your profile. You can also use the app to write and publish new articles.

The app provides a basic text editor for writing your content and supports the addition of images and links. You can preview your content and see how it will look on the Substack platform before you publish it. Once you are ready to publish, simply hit the “Publish” button, and your content will be live on your Substack page.

Writing using Markdown

Another option for writing on Substack using your mobile device is to use a Markdown editor. Markdown is a simple and lightweight markup language that makes it easy to format your content for the web. There are many Markdown editors available for both iOS and Android devices, such as iA Writer, Ulysses, and Byword.

Using a Markdown editor allows you to write your content using a simple syntax, and then preview it in real-time as you write. You can then copy and paste your content into the Substack editor and publish it directly from your mobile device.

Using the Substack Website on Your Mobile Browser

Finally, if you don’t have access to the Substack app or a Markdown editor, you can still write and publish your content using the Substack website on your mobile browser. Simply log in to your Substack account and access the editor from your mobile browser. You can write and format your content using the editor and publish it directly from your mobile device.

While using the Substack website on your mobile browser may not be as streamlined as using the app or a Markdown editor, it still provides a functional solution for writing and publishing your content on the go.
